Hideo Kojima dropped the latest production update on PHYSINT during Xbox's Tokyo Game Show 2026 broadcast, confirming Swedish actor Bill Skarsgård as the lead protagonist.
Skarsgård joins previously announced cast members Charlee Fraser, Don Lee, and Minami Hamabe in the action-espionage title, now fully under Xbox Game Studios publishing after PlayStation Studios walked away from the project in mid-June. Kojima described the move as a search for a partner sharing a common vision, while Sony framed it as a difficult decision amid reports citing budget concerns, missed deadlines, and profitability questions.
The director highlighted recent costume fittings, scans, and camera tests with Skarsgård and Fraser as giving him tremendous confidence, backed by a new poster he personally shot carrying the tagline "The Next Cold War Begins." Kojima called PHYSINT the culmination of his 40-year career and a project unbound by existing genres, though no platforms, release window, or gameplay details emerged.
Xbox and Kojima Productions already collaborate on the horror title OD, and the PHYSINT partnership extends to film and television ambitions.
